Elin
Nordegren Woods, wife of No.1 golfer Tiger Woods, has settled
out of court her lawsuit against the Dubliner magazine. The mag
published fake nude photos of Elin Nordegren, right before the
Ryder Cup start last year. The magazine linked Nordegren Woods
to adult Web sites and printed pictures in which her head had
been superimposed onto another woman's body under the title
“Ryder Filth for Dublin”. Nordegren Woods filed to lawsuit on
November of 2006 and today the magazine publisher came with the
statement that the lawsuit with Elin Woods had been settled. As
part of the settlement the magazine will pay unknown sum to
cancer support charities. According to some reports the Dubliner
will pay $182,000 over a 2-year period. If the magazine fails to
pay out the money, it will be liable for another $182,000.
"The false and deeply offensive article
in The Dubliner magazine, with the accompanying photograph of
another woman wrongly claimed to be me, caused great personal
distress to me and my family," was the statement made by Elin
Nordegren.
